New Trends in AI Talent Compensation
In a groundbreaking report released by Pave, an AI compensation platform, and Nua Group, a human resource consulting firm, insights into the evolving landscape of AI talent compensation have aroused significant interest across the tech industry. The report, aptly titled
The State of AI Talent: A Compensation Workforce Report, provides a detailed analysis of the compensation structures for AI and Machine Learning (ML) professionals, showing the unique facets of this emerging job market.
A Deep Dive into Compensation Structures
With insights drawn from Pave's expansive real-time compensation dataset, encompassing over 9,000 companies—including a staggering 80% of the Forbes AI 50—the report highlights a pivotal shift in how companies compensate their AI professionals. This dataset is not merely a collection of past data; it includes real-time information sourced through constant connections to human resource information systems (HRIS), applicant tracking systems (ATS), and equity management systems.
One of the most striking findings from this comprehensive report is the distinguishing characteristics of compensation among different job families within the AI domain. The data reveals that AI roles have matured considerably, leading to a classification that separates AI Engineering, ML Engineering, and AI Research Scientist into distinct job families. Each of these categories possesses its own unique pay scale, seniority mix, and hiring trajectories.
Equity Takes Center Stage
Among the key revelations of the report is the staggering realization that equity grants are where the real compensation premium lies. Interestingly, while median base salaries across the core job families exhibit relative compression, AI Research Scientists stand out with median new-hire equity grants soaring to approximately $4.09 million and $4.72 million at the P6 and M6 levels, respectively. In stark contrast, their counterparts in ML Engineering receive significantly lower equity packages at similar levels, revealing a distinct disparity in compensation packages based on specializations.
Furthermore, for senior-level AI Research Scientists at private companies located in the San Francisco Bay Area—specifically those that have raised between $1 billion to $5 billion—new-hire equity packages can climb to an astounding $45 million to $60 million, marking an important trend in how companies vie for AI talent.
Rapid Growth in AI Engineering Roles
The report underscores that AI Engineering has emerged as the fastest-growing job family, experiencing an exponential growth in share from a mere 0.010% of employees in Q4 2023 to an impressive 0.185% by Q2 2026. Furthermore, the share of new hires in AI Engineering surged from 0.11% to 0.35% during the same period, a staggering tenfold increase that signals the increasing importance of this specialized field within the tech industry.
Challenges in Retaining AI/ML Talent
Despite the apparent boom, companies face significant challenges in retaining their AI/ML talent, as evidenced by the turnover rate of individual contributors, which reached 21.8% in the past year—substantially higher than the turnover rate of 16.8% seen in traditional software engineering roles within the same companies. Moreover, a concerning trend is emerging where recent hires into AI roles are out-earning their longer-standing counterparts, with some new hires commanding base salary premiums of up to 10% over incumbent employees at the same level.
A Call for Tailored Compensation Strategies
In light of these findings, the report also presents a framework developed by Nua Group, urging companies to 'know their AI lane' when structuring compensation packages. This framework categorizes organizations as AI Innovators, AI Integrators, or AI Implementers, each with a distinctly tailored hiring profile and compensation strategy.
As Ryland Bauer, Total Rewards Advisor at Nua Group, aptly points out, the most critical error companies make is not about overpaying—but rather misallocating compensation for the wrong AI roles. Understanding the differences amongst AI jobs and structuring compensation accordingly will provide companies with a strategic advantage in this evolving job market.
